Abstract: An experimental study was carried out to investigate the effects of cutting parameters on cutting force and temperature in cutting of hardened W18Cr4V with PCBN cutter. Three components of cutting force were recorded by a strain-gauge dynamometer and the cutting temperature was measured by a nature thermocouple of tool-workpiece. The cutting parameters were arranged by orthogonal method. It is shown that the cutting temperature increased with each of the three cutting parameters and the main effecting factor is feeding speed. The three components of cutting force increased greatly with an increase in feeding speed and cutting depth. But the forces decreased a little as cutting speed increased. The main and axial cutting forces depend mainly on cutting depth whereas the radius force is mainly influenced by feeding speed.

Abstract: This paper presents the parameters optimization by TRIZ theory in the precision lapping of sapphire in order to realize the high efficiency and low damaged lapping. The TRIZ theory was used to optimize processing parameters of sapphire precision lapping based on much experimental data of lapping, then the conflict matrix of internal contradictions was set up and the optimization parameters was obtained. The result of experiment indicated that the face quality of sapphire was improved greatly after optimized by TRIZ. There was a conclusion that TRIZ theory can be used to optimize the processing parameters of sapphire precision lapping which is important to enrich the processing theory of sapphire.

Abstract: In order to resolve the problem of connecting rod notches machining, a new process of WEDM (Wire Electric Discharge Machine) has been presented, and it is greatly possible that expensive laser process can be replaced by WEDM in virtue of its unique advantages. Firstly, process parameters of notch have been analyzed, and project of machining notch using WEDM has been introduced, including measures to achieve good-quality notch. The relationship between cutting speed and power supply parameters has been investigated, and it is discovered that micro-crackle on bottom of notch are greatly effect to fracture splitting process, also new idea of active controlling micro-crackle has been presented. Finally, fracture splitting machining has been carried out. The cost and entrance standard of fracture splitting process are greatly dropped owing to new breakthrough of machining notch using WEDM.

Abstract: In this paper, Taguchi method was applied to design the cutting experiments when end milling Inconel 718 with the TiAlN-TiN coated carbide inserts. The signal-to-noise (S/N) ratio are employed to study the effects of cutting parameters (cutting speed, feed per tooth, radial depth of cut, and axial depth of cut) on surface roughness, and the optimal combination of the cutting parameters for the desired surface roughness is obtained. An exponential regression model for the surface roughness is formulated based on the experimental results. Finally, the verification tests show that surface roughness generated by the optimal cutting parameters is really the minimum value, and there is a good agreement between the predictive results and experimental measurements.

Abstract: High performance cemented carbide YG610 was adopted for remanufacture hardness deposited materials cutting experiment. The experiment results showed that the same conclusions can be drawn from two group orthogonal experiments. The influence order on cutting capability of cutting tools was: feed rate﹥cutting speed﹥ cutting depth. The cutting length of cutting tools increases monotonously with the feed rate decrease. And the effects by the cutting depth were comparatively small, which is almost negligible in hardness materials cutting. Therefore,low feed rate and large depth of cut are beneficial to keep cutting capability of cutting tools and improve manufacturing productivity. By the results of two orthogonal experiments and extreme deviation analysis, the optimal scheme for cutting parameters were achieved after calculating the best level of the factor.
